These policy debates hosted the Congressional Internet Caucus Advisory Committee examine the latest technology issues before Congressional lawmakers including digital copyright protection, safety, security and privacy on the Internet, wireless and broadband issues, e-surveillance, and more. Subscribe to this podcast to hear the critical issues being debated in Congress that affect the technology revolution.
The Internet Caucus Advisory Committee and the Internet Education Foundation, with participation from members of the Internet Caucus, host regular events and forums for policymakers, the press, and the public to discuss important Internet-related policy issues. “Through the League Lens” is a show produced by the League of Women Voters of Amherst, MA, originally as a television show. It is in an interview format with guests who are usually residents of the Amherst area. Some topics relate to issues on which the League of Women Voters has a position. There is also an attempt to have regular shows with the State Senator and Representative representing Amherst in the MA Legislature. While many of the shows have a local focus, most are of general interest. They span such topics as municipal government, housing, local planning, topics related to Amherst history, leisure services in Amherst, Learning in Retirement, casino gambling, education, the environment, health care, election reform, issues at the University of Mass., and the state legislature. The show is hosted by Elisa Campbell and produced by Mary Jane Laus and Alice Swift. It is recorded in the studio of Amherst Media.

IN*SOURCE, the Indiana Resource Center for Families with Special Needs, was incorporated in 1975 under the name of the Task Force on Education for the Handicapped, Inc. It is governed by a Board of Directors. The mission of IN*SOURCE is to provide parents, families, and service providers in Indiana with the information and training necessary to help assure effective educational programs and appropriate services for children and young adults with disabilities.

WHJE is an award winning, non-commercial educational radio station broadcasting from Carmel High School in Carmel, Indiana. This student-run station airs 18 original weekly shows, plus all major Carmel HS sports broadcasts. In addition, WHJE students produce numerous community affairs programs focusing on a wide array of topics.
